Karen Hughes' Mission 'Rude,' 'Insensitive,' 'Tactless'
Jordan paper doesn't think much of bushco's foreign policy, either.


http://watchingamerica.com/thestar000001.shtml

What kind of diplomacy does Hughes practice when she comes to Saudi Arabia
on an official visit, meets with the country’s leadership, and then turns to
Saudi women and incites them against a law on the books in their country?

Regardless of the correctness of that law and whether or not it is just, the
point here is how rude and absurd it is to interfere in a country’s internal
affairs with that kind of insensitivity and lack of diplomatic tact, while
on an official visit. Personally speaking, this is just another in a series
of blunders, just another sign of arrogance by an American Administration
that has become a role model for “global dictatorship” presented to the
world under the guise of “Globalization.”

Hughes faced heated and emotional complaints about U.S. foreign policy, and
her only defense was the pre-packaged and boring cliché that war is
necessary for peace; a distinctive feature of the U.S. Administration, which
is best referred to as “spin.”

<snip>

Instead of reconsidering America’s colonial foreign policy that taking
Washington from one war to another, creating foes in every corner of the
globe, the U.S. Administration wants the world to change the basic,
instinctive sense of justice that man has been created with. Americans want
to know why there is growing hatred toward everything American. The only
answers they receive, however, are those given them by their own media
monopoly giants that have for so long claimed to be fair and independent.
